网络安全工程师的需求可以从多个维度进行分析,包括教育背景、技术技能、工作经验、认证以及行业需求等。以下是一些关键的需求点:
教育背景
通常要求具备计算机科学、信息技术、网络安全、电子工程或相关专业的本科及以上学历。
某些情况下,硕士学位可能更为理想,特别是在复杂的网络安全管理或技术架构设计方面。
技术技能
熟悉常见的操作系统和数据库系统。
精通网络协议和网络安全技术,包括端口扫描、服务漏洞分析、程序漏洞检测、权限管理、入侵和攻击分析追踪、网站渗透、病毒木马防范等。
熟悉TCP/IP协议,了解SQL注入原理和手工检测、内存缓冲区溢出原理和防范措施、信息存储和传输安全、数据包结构、DDos攻击类型和原理,并有一定的DDos攻防经验。
熟悉Windows或Linux系统,并精通至少一种编程语言如PHP/Shell/Perl/Python/C/C++。
工作经验
需要具备三年以上网络安全领域的工作经验。
有实际的安全系统设计和实施经验,能够保护企业免受网络攻击和威胁。
认证
许多雇主要求网络安全工程师具备相关认证,如CISSP(Certified Information Systems Security Professional)。
其他可能需要的认证包括CEH(Certified Ethical Hacker)、CISM(Certified Information Security Manager)等。
其他要求
具备较强的学习能力和团队合作精神。
良好的沟通能力和责任心,能够高效地完成工作任务。
具备严谨的思维和对安全事故的应急处理能力。
行业需求
随着数字化转型的加速,网络安全工程师的需求日益增长,特别是在5G、人工智能、大数据、云计算等新技术的广泛应用背景下。
全球范围内网络安全人才短缺,尤其是具备实战经验的专业人才。
综上所述,网络安全工程师的需求是多方面且不断增长的。为了满足这些需求,候选人不仅需要具备扎实的技术基础,还需要有一定的工作经验和认证,同时还需要具备良好的沟通能力和团队合作精神。